My friend recommended me this guy Oscar Aleman cuz he knows i like Django and his rec came with the comment that some ppl say he was the Argentinean Django, that he just as a good and so similar you cant tell them apart but from what I've heard from him so far, i dont think thats true.





He's good, dont get me wrong but his arrangements dont seem as guitar driven as Django instead it seems more focused on the overall sound of the band. I gotta listen to him more to see if he's just as good but so far he's not and it's not that hard to tell their sound apart.
